Project Description
This coursework reconstructs the built Park Slope Townhouse project using Revit, focusing on digital replication of its architectural logic and technical detailing. Based on the original design by Resolution: 4 Architecture (2020), the exercise provided a hands-on understanding of residential BIM workflows.
The modeling process included wall assemblies, structural systems, façade components, and stair sections, aiming to capture both the spatial articulation and construction rationale. By interpreting a realized project, the work tested the limits of Revit as a representational and coordination tool.
Ultimately, this coursework served as a technical deep-dive into BIM practice, reinforcing precision in design communication and enhancing fluency in digital modeling across scales.
